운영
국내 계좌〉결과조회
연동하기
웹훅(Webhook)을 통한 결제 결과 수신에 실패한 경우에도 결제 결과를 확인하실 수 있습니다.
한 번의 파트너 인증 후 30분의 유효 시간 동안 조회 요청을 해야 합니다.
단건 조회는 1초에 2건, 10분당 1,000건을 초과하는 요청은 거부됩니다.
다건 조회는 1초에 1건, 2분당 20건을 초과하는 요청은 거부됩니다.
연동 흐름
1. 파트너 인증 요청
Server단건 조회
Header 설정 후 API를 요청해주세요.
POSThttps://democpay.payple.kr/php/auth.php테스트 환경
POSThttps://cpay.payple.kr/php/auth.php라이브 환경
Header
1Content-Type: application/json
2Cache-Control: no-cache
3Referer: https://your-domain.comBody
JSON
1{
2 "cst_id": "test",
3 "custKey": "abcd1234567890",
4 "PCD_PAYCHK_FLAG": "Y"
5}·주의사항
Referer 필드에는 페이플에 등록된 파트너(상점)의 도메인을 정확히 입력해주세요. 도메인이 일치하지 않을 경우, ‘AUTH0004’ 오류 메시지가 반환됩니다.
다건 조회
다건 조회 API에서도 파트너 인증 요청 방식은 단건 조회와 동일합니다.
다건 조회 인증/요청에는 PCD_PAYCHK_LIST_FLAG를 사용합니다.
2. 결과 조회 요청
Server단건 조회
Header 설정 후 API를 요청해주세요.
POSThttps://democpay.payple.kr/php/PayChkAct.php테스트 환경
POSThttps://cpay.payple.kr/php/PayChkAct.php라이브 환경
Header
1Content-Type: application/json
2Cache-Control: no-cache
3Referer: https://your-domain.comBody
JSON
1{
2 "PCD_CST_ID": "UFVNNVZ...",
3 "PCD_CUST_KEY": "T3JzRkp5L...",
4 "PCD_AUTH_KEY": "a688ccb3555...",
5 "PCD_PAYCHK_FLAG": "Y",
6 "PCD_PAY_TYPE": "transfer",
7 "PCD_PAY_OID": "order12345",
8 "PCD_PAY_DATE": "20231219"
9}·주의사항
Referer 필드에는 페이플에 등록된 파트너(상점)의 도메인을 정확히 입력해주세요. 도메인이 일치하지 않을 경우, ‘AUTH0004’ 오류 메시지가 반환됩니다.
다건 조회
Header 설정 후 API를 요청해주세요.
첫 요청에서는 PCD_LASTKEY를 생략하고, 응답의 PCD_HAS_MORE가 true이면 반환된 PCD_LASTKEY를 다음 요청에 포함합니다.
POSThttps://democpay.payple.kr/php/PayChkActList.php테스트 환경
POSThttps://cpay.payple.kr/php/PayChkActList.php라이브 환경
Header
1Content-Type: application/json
2Cache-Control: no-cache
3Referer: https://your-domain.com첫 요청 Body
JSON
1{
2 "PCD_CST_ID": "UFVNNVZ...",
3 "PCD_CUST_KEY": "T3JzRkp5L...",
4 "PCD_AUTH_KEY": "a688ccb3555...",
5 "PCD_PAYCHK_LIST_FLAG": "Y",
6 "PCD_START_DATE": "20231219",
7 "PCD_END_DATE": "20231219",
8 "PCD_PAY_TYPE": "transfer",
9 "PCD_LIMIT": 5000
10}다음 페이지 요청 Body
JSON
1{
2 "PCD_CST_ID": "UFVNNVZ...",
3 "PCD_CUST_KEY": "T3JzRkp5L...",
4 "PCD_AUTH_KEY": "a688ccb3555...",
5 "PCD_PAYCHK_LIST_FLAG": "Y",
6 "PCD_START_DATE": "20231219",
7 "PCD_END_DATE": "20231219",
8 "PCD_PAY_TYPE": "transfer",
9 "PCD_LIMIT": 5000,
10 "PCD_LASTKEY": "gmUZOwXKxH64MWh3CsL3xg=="
11}Response
JSON
1{
2 "PCD_PAY_CODE": "PCHK0000",
3 "PCD_PAY_MSG": "success",
4 "PCD_DATA": {
5 "PCD_HAS_MORE": true,
6 "PCD_LASTKEY": "gmUZOwXKxH64MWh3CsL3xg==",
7 "PCD_LIMIT": 5000,
8 "PCD_CONTENT": [
9 {
10 "PCD_CST_ID": "PAYLAP01",
11 "PCD_PAY_OID": "order12345",
12 "PCD_PAY_TIME": "2023-12-19 13:42:23",
13 "PCD_PAY_TYPE": "transfer",
14 "PCD_PAYER_NO": "1234",
15 "PCD_PAYER_ID": "OVA3...",
16 "PCD_PAYER_EMAIL": "complete@payer-email.com",
17 "PCD_PAY_YEAR": "2023",
18 "PCD_PAY_MONTH": "12",
19 "PCD_PAY_GOODS": "테스트 상품",
20 "PCD_PAY_AMOUNT": 1000,
21 "PCD_PAY_TOTAL": 1000,
22 "PCD_PAY_ISTAX": "Y",
23 "PCD_PAY_TAXTOTAL": 500,
24 "PCD_REGULER_FLAG": "N",
25 "PCD_PAY_STATE": "결제완료",
26 "PCD_PAYER_NAME": "홍길동",
27 "PCD_PAYER_HP": "01012345678",
28 "PCD_PAY_BANK": "020",
29 "PCD_PAY_BANKNAME": "우리은행",
30 "PCD_PAY_BANKNUM": "123-********-456",
31 "PCD_TAXSAVE_FLAG": "Y",
32 "PCD_TAXSAVE_RST": "Y",
33 "PCD_TAXSAVE_MGTNUM": "G123456"
34 }
35 ]
36 }
37}·주의사항
Referer 필드에는 페이플에 등록된 파트너(상점)의 도메인을 정확히 입력해주세요. 도메인이 일치하지 않을 경우, ‘AUTH0004’ 오류 메시지가 반환됩니다.